Bill Maher Slaps Back at Gavin Newsom for Calling Left Wing Democrats ‘Toxic’: ‘You Were the Poster Boy for This Stuff!’ from Mediaite Zachary Leeman

Bill Maher reminded California Gov. Gavin Newsom (D) has was the “poster boy” for many of the Democratic Party policies he now identifies as “toxic.”

Newsom joined Maher on Friday’s Real Time where the governor praised Maher for agreeing to meet President Donald Trump at the White House, arguing that level of dialogue is what he’s trying to create with his This Is Gavin Newsom podcast where he’s talked with right-wing figures like Steve Bannon and Charlie Kirk.

Newsom said:

We’re in the same damn echo chamber, these guys are crushing us. The Democratic brand is toxic right now. We had a high water mark two weeks ago, and that was a CNN poll at 29 percent favorability. It’s dropped in the NBC poll down to 27 percent. It’s one thing to make noise, but you also have to make sense. And I think with this podcast and having the opportunity to dialog with people I disagree with, it’s an opportunity to try to find common ground and not take cheap shots.

Maher praised Newsom and at one point pushed him to run for the White House, but he also argued many see him as the “poster boy” for bad Democratic policies, citing red tape in California and his past positions on trans youths.

“What do you say to people who say, well, this sounds all very good, but governor, you were the poster boy for a lot of this stuff?” Maher asked.

Newsom has faced similar backlash before like when he recently announced he had never used the term “LatinX,” only for critics to pull up past video of him using that very term.

Maher cited a law in California that would prevent teachers from being fired if they do not report a child “talking about gender identity.” Newsom defended the law, saying he only supported teachers not being fired, but argued teachers can still legally inform parents if their child has expressed gender identity issues.

Democrats, Newsom said, “need to mature” and move beyond “cancel culture” and echo chambers, citing low favorability polling for the party.

“Democrats tend to be a little more judgmental than we should be. This notion of cancel culture, you’ve been living it, you’ve on the receiving end of it. For years and years and years, that’s real. And Democrats need to own up to that. They’ve got to mature,” he said.

GAVIN NEWSOM: This idea that we can’t even have a conversation with the other side —

BILL MAHER: You have to. They won!

NEWSOM: Thank you. That’s it. Bottom line. And by the way, or the notion we just have to continue to talk to ourselves, or we’re in the same damn echo chamber, these guys are crushing us. The Democratic brand is toxic right now. We had a high water mark two weeks ago, and that was a CNN poll at 29 percent favorability. It’s dropped in the NBC poll down to 27 percent. It’s one thing to make noise, but you also have to make sense. And I think with this podcast and having the opportunity to dialog with people I disagree with, it’s an opportunity to try to find common ground and not take cheap shots. I’m not looking to put a spoke in the wheel of their, or at least a crowbar in the spokes of their wheel to trip them up to your point. And I thinks it’s important. Democrats tend to be a little more judgmental than we should be. This notion of cancel culture, you’ve been living it, you’ve on the receiving end of it. For years and years and years, that’s real. And Democrats need to own up to that. They’ve got to mature.

MAHER: So, what do you say to people who say, well, this sounds all very good, but governor, you were the poster boy for a lot of this stuff. I see today the Trump administration is, they talked about, I don’t know if this is true, but they talked the fact that California had a rule that schools cannot be required to notify parents if their kids in school have changed their gender, their pronouns. That’s the kind of thing, even though it doesn’t affect a lot of people, that makes a lot people go, well, you know what, that’s the party without common sense. Now, if that’s your state, how are you, are you —

NEWSOM: I mean, the law was you would be fired, a teacher would be fired if a teacher did not report or snitch on a kid talking about their gender identity. I just think that was wrong. I think teachers should teach. I don’t think they should be required to turn in kids. And by the way, they —

MAHER: We’re talking about their parents, how can you snitch? The idea of a snitch and a parent to me doesn’t compare.

NEWSOM: I just, I don’t, but what is the job of a teacher? It’s to teach. If Johnny’s talking about some identity issue or some issue about liking someone of the same sex, is it the teacher’s job to then report that? By the way, in this law, the teacher can still do that, but they can’t be fired if that’s what, can’t fired if not what they do. And that’s something I think is, I just think that was fair.
